What are HIBT Sanctions Checks?
HIBT sanctions checks are a set of compliance procedures designed to identify and mitigate risks associated with transactions involving individuals or entities that are subject to sanctions. This process is crucial for any crypto platform that wishes to operate within a legal framework, especially in today’s climate where regulatory scrutiny is increasing.

How to Conduct HIBT Sanctions Checks
- Identify Sanctioned Individuals: Regularly update your databases to ensure you’re not engaging with sanctioned individuals or entities.
- Utilize Advanced Software: Tools like the HIBT compliance suite help automate checks.
- Implement Reporting Mechanisms: Ensure seamless reporting processes to flag potential breaches.
